What Types of Engineers Are Involved in the Construction Industry?
The term “engineer” covers a wide range of specialties in construction. Each type of engineer plays a different role, and they all work together to make sure a project runs smoothly. Here are some of the most common types of engineers in the construction industry:
1. Civil Engineers
Civil engineers are probably the most well-known engineers in the construction industry. They design and oversee large-scale infrastructure projects, including bridges, highways, water treatment facilities, and dams. Their job is to ensure that the structures are safe, functional, and built to last.
2. Structural Engineers
Structural engineers focus on the design and analysis of buildings and structures. They make sure that buildings are sturdy enough to withstand various stresses, including weight loads, wind pressure, and natural disasters. Without structural engineers, buildings would not stand the test of time.
3. Mechanical Engineers
Mechanical engineers design and implement systems within buildings, such as heating, ventilation, and air conditioning (HVAC) systems. They also work on elevators, escalators, and other mechanical aspects that make a building comfortable and functional.
4. Electrical Engineers
Electrical engineers handle the electrical systems within construction projects. This includes wiring, lighting, power distribution, and safety systems. They ensure that buildings have efficient, safe, and reliable electrical systems.
5. Environmental Engineers
Environmental engineers focus on minimizing the environmental impact of construction projects. They work to ensure projects are sustainable, with efficient water use, energy conservation, and waste management systems. They also help with compliance to environmental regulations.

How Do Engineers Help Reduce Costs in Construction?
Construction projects can be expensive, but engineers play a significant role in reducing costs without compromising quality. Here’s how they help save money in construction:
1. Accurate Budgeting
Engineers estimate the costs of materials, labor, and equipment, ensuring that the project stays within budget. They can also identify areas where cost savings can be made, such as using alternative materials or methods.
2. Efficient Design
By optimizing the design, engineers ensure that materials are used effectively and waste is minimized. A good design can lead to less material waste, fewer labor hours, and a shorter construction timeline.
3. Risk Management
Engineers anticipate potential risks and create plans to avoid them. Whether it’s a construction delay or unexpected complications, engineers have contingency plans that help prevent costly mistakes.
